Lets compare vitamin content per 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t vs Navel Oranges:
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t have 1.4 times more Vitamin B3 than Navel Oranges.
- While 7 oz of Raw Navel Oranges contain 1.8 times more Vitamin B2, 3.6 times more Vitamin B5, 5.3 times more Vitamin B6, 2 times more Vitamin B9 and more Vitamin C than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t.
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t and Navel Oranges prov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1 per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6 and Vitamin C
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t as well as Raw Navel Oranges have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B12, Vitamin D, Vitamin E and Vitamin K in seven ounces.
Comparing minerals per 7 ounces for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t vs Navel Oranges:
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t have 2.1 times more Calcium, 30.7 times more Iron, more Selenium and 129 times more Sodium than Navel Oranges.
- While 7 oz of Raw Navel Oranges contain 2.2 times more Magnesium, 1.4 times more Phosphorus and 9.8 times more Potassium than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t.
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t and Navel Oranges contain similar levels of Copper and Water per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t lack sufficient amounts of Magnesium and Potassium
- 7 ounces of Navel Oranges lack sufficient amounts of Iron and Selenium
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t as well as Raw Navel Oranges lack sufficient amounts of Manganese and Zinc in seven 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 7 ounces:
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t have 1.6 times more Protein than Navel Oranges.
- While 7 oz of Raw Navel Oranges contain 283.3 times more Sugars and 4.4 times more Fiber than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t.
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t and Navel Oranges offer comparable quantities of Carbohydrate per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t provide inadequate amounts of Fiber
- 7 ounces of Navel Oranges provide inadequate amounts of Protein
- Both Cereals, CREAM OF WHEAT, regular (10 minute), cooked with water, with salt as well as Raw Navel Oranges provide inadequate amounts of Energy, Omega 3 and Omega 6 in seven ounces.
